The New Orleans Saints extended Chris Olave to a long-term contract this offseason and drafted Jordyn Tyson in the first round of the 2026 NFL Draft. While both have shaky injury histories, when healthy, they should form an incredible duo.
Unfortunately, before they even got a chance to play together in the regular season, there is already a seemingly serious injury for Tyson due to a hamstring problem.
ESPN's Katherine Terrell reports that Tyson will miss some time due to a hamstring injury, and it could even "linger" into the regular season.
"Saints rookie wide receiver Jordyn Tyson has a right hamstring issue and will miss time, according to Saints coach Kellen Moore," Terrell reports. "Moore said that he's not going to estimate a timetable for Tyson's return yet, but when asked about the regular season, he said 'it could' potentially linger into Week 1."
